Confounded
A situation in experimental design where the effects of two variables cannot be separated, leading to ambiguity in results interpretation.
Lurking Variables
Variables that are not included as explanatory or independent variables in the analysis but can affect the relationship between the variables studied.
Randomize
To arrange or assign subjects, treatments, or sequences in a random manner to reduce bias in experimental design.
Blinding
A research design technique where one or more parties in an experiment are unaware of the treatment assignments to prevent bias.
